SEAP: Sensor Enablement for the Average Programmer TR-UTEDGE-2008-007
نویسندگان
چکیده
The increasing availability of sensing devices has made the possibility of context-aware ubiquitous computing applications real. However, constructing this software requires extensive knowledge about the devices and specialized programming languages for interacting with them. While the nature of ubiquitous computing lends users to demand individualized applications, complexities render programming embedded devices unapproachable to the average programmer. In this paper we introduce the SEAP (Sensor Enablement for the Average Programmer) approach which applies existing technologies developed for web programming to the task of collecting and using sensor data. We show how this approach can be used to create new applications and to update existing web applications to accept sensor data. ACM Classification
منابع مشابه
Application Sessions: Conversation Abstractions for Pervasive Computing TR-UTEDGE-2010-014
Pervasive computing application development demands abstractions that reify the notion of a conversation among distributed entities in dynamic and unpredictable environments. We define the Application Sessions model for representing and managing long-term conversations on behalf of applications. This model has been designed to remove the application developer’s need for intimate familiarity wit...
متن کاملEgoSpaces: Facilitating Rapid Development of Context-Aware Mobile Applications TR-UTEDGE-2005-004
Today’s mobile applications require constant adaptation to their changing environments, or contexts. Technological advancements have increased the pervasiveness of mobile computing devices such as laptops, handhelds, and embedded sensors. The sheer amount of context information available for adaptation places a heightened burden on application developers as they must manage and utilize vast amo...
متن کاملVirtual Sensors: Abstracting Data from Physical Sensors TR-UTEDGE-2006-001
Sensor networks are becoming increasingly pervasive. Existing methods of aggregation in sensor networks offer mostly standard mathematical operators over homogeneous data types. In this paper, we instead focus on supporting emerging scenarios in which applications will need to extract abstracted measurements from diverse sets of sensor network nodes. This paper introduces the virtual sensors ab...
متن کاملذخیره در منابع من
با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ید
عنوان ژورنال:
دوره شماره
صفحات -
تاریخ انتشار 2008